Technical memorandum evaluates four techniques for determining location laminar flow about airfoil changes to turbulent flow. Studied in flight experiments on F-14 variable-sweep-wing aircraft. First technique involved measurements by hot-film anemometer sensors. Second, measurements by boundary-layer rakes, each array of pressure probes. Third, measurements taken by pitot tubes arrayed on airfoil, flush with surface, and fourth, test airfoil surface coated with pressure-sensitive liquid crystals, to make pressure pattern of flow visible.
